An established, design led architectural studio in Edinburgh is seeking a mid level Architectural Technologist to join their team as they continue to expand their residential and mixed use portfolio across Scotland. They have built a strong reputation for delivering high quality build to rent, large scale residential and urban mixed use schemes that balance commercial awareness with thoughtful design.
With a healthy pipeline of projects both in planning and on site, they are looking for someone who enjoys the technical challenge of complex developments and wants to play a key role in delivering them properly. This position is suited to a Technologist with solid UK experience who is confident producing detailed drawing packages and coordinating information through later RIBA stages.
They are particularly interested in candidates with strong Revit capability, as the studio operates within a BIM led environment and values clear, coordinated technical information. Revit experience is highly desirable and will be a significant advantage.
The successful candidate will be involved in the preparation of technical and construction information, ensuring compliance with current Scottish building regulations and working closely with consultants to resolve design and coordination issues. They will liaise with structural and MEP engineers, attend project meetings where required and support the delivery of information to site teams.
A good understanding of large residential detailing, fire strategy coordination and envelope interfaces would be beneficial. This is a full time, office based position in Edinburgh.
